  Description: "Erase the LUKS keys with a special password on the unlock prompt\n\
    \ Installing this package lets you configure a special \"nuke password\" that\n\
    \ can be used to destroy the encryption keys required to unlock the encrypted\n\
    \ partitions. This password can be entered in the usual early-boot prompt\n asking\
    \ the passphrase to unlock the encrypted partition(s).\n .\n This provides a relatively\
    \ stealth way to make your data unreadable in\n case you fear that your computer\
    \ is going to be seized.\n .\n After installation, use \u201Cdpkg-reconfigure\
    \ cryptsetup-nuke-password\u201D to\n configure your nuke password."
